Cherry Bomb Extreme Conundrum
So I put on a nice CB Extreme about 2 months ago and I have just had the exhaust exiting the side with a piece of flex pipe since the muffler is a hell of a lot shorter than the old one and the exit is a center, not offset. Now comes the time when I want to stop inhaling exhaust gases and actually make the thing legal by tying it into the tailpipe again. Problem is, I can't run a straight piece of pipe from the muffler to the tailpipe because the tailpipe likes to hit the shock and leaf spring when I move it to the side. I need to somehow bend an 18 inch piece of 2.5 diameter pipe into a 15 inch "S" shape to compensate for the muffler exit and shortness. To all those fab guys, is that possible or would the bends be too tight? To everybody in general, have you ever used this same muffler and what did you do to compensate? The part number is 7426 if that helps any. I don't have a pipe bender but I have friends with torches to heat and bend it. I tried once before and it kinked the pipe a little, so I need to take a different approach. Maybe bending it over a rim or other round object? Thanks for any help!

I had this exact problem when I ran a glasspack, because it was straight through it turned the tailpipe sideways and never sealed, even had an exhaust shop try to fix it and they got it wrong, but still charged me for it. Fixed it by getting an offset thrush turbo muffler, which sounds A LOT better and seals perfectly.
IMHO glasspacks sound absolutely horrible on 4.0s
